What Ironoaks CC&Rs (Sun Lakes HOA)'s governing documents say

IronOaks at Sun Lakes is an age-restricted master-planned residential community in Arizona where you own individual lots with single-family homes; at least 80% of homes must be occupied by someone 55+, and the remaining 20% by someone 40+. The Association maintains common areas (including a golf course) and is funded by annual per-lot assessments. As a property owner, you're subject to architectural review, landscaping maintenance requirements, and restrictions on vehicles, pets, and property modifications.

Key facts from Ironoaks CC&Rs (Sun Lakes HOA)'s documents

Reflects the 2014 governing documents — figures and rules are as originally recorded and may have changed since.

Community type
Age-restricted residential community (Article IV, Section 2.B)
Legal name
Sun Lakes Homeowners Association No. 3, Inc., doing business as IronOaks at Sun Lakes (Article I, definition G)
Developer / declarant
Sun Lakes Homeowners Association No. 3, Inc. (the Association) is the entity executing this Declaration; Original Declarant defined as Sun Lakes Marketing Limited Partnership (Introductory paragraph; Article I, Defin)
Governing law
Arizona law governs; Association is an Arizona nonprofit corporation (Article XV, Section 9; Introductory para)
Age restriction
At least 80% of Dwelling Units must be occupied by at least one person 55 years or older; remaining units must have at least one person 40 years or older (Article IV, Section 2.B)
Assessments & dues
Set annually by Board; no specific amount given (Article IX, Section 4)
Special assessments
Owner Special Assessments and New Owner Special Assessments may be levied (Article IX, Section 5)
Collections & liens
Assessments and Delinquency Charges create a lien on the Lot; Association can foreclose the lien (Article IX, Sections 2 and 12)
Reserves & fees
Reserve Fund for Replacement and Repair established; Board administers (Article X, Section 5; Article VI, Sectio)
Pets
Yes, generally recognized house or yard pets; kept as domestic pets only (Article IV, Section 2.D)
Leasing & rentals
Yes, entire Dwelling Unit and Lot may be leased to a Single Family (Article IV, Section 2.Bb)
Parking & vehicles
Vehicles shall be kept in garages and other approved parking areas (Article IV, Section 2.U(1))
Fences
Fences not required between Lots and Golf Course/Common Area; no restriction on removal; any fence on Lot adjoining Golf Course/Common Area maintained by Owner (Article IV, Section 2.R)
Architectural approval
ALC approval required before beginning any work (construction, modification, etc.) (Article XIII, Section 4)
Solar & roof
Require prior written ALC approval; must comply with applicable law (Article IV, Section 2.V)
Home business
Business Activity allowed if not apparent/detectable from outside, conforms to zoning, no door-to-door solicitation, consistent with residential character (Article IV, Section 2.C)
Signs & flags
No sign on any Lot unless required by legal proceeding, approved in advance by Association, or allowed by state law (Article IV, Section 2.O)
Setbacks / home size
At least 1,000 square feet of living space, not including garages and porches (Article IV, Section 2.A)
Insurance
Association has authority to purchase insurance (Article XI, Section 1)
Use restrictions
Lots used exclusively for residential purposes; home businesses allowed with restrictions (not detectable, conform to zoning, no solicitation, consistent with residential character) (Article IV, Section 2.C)
Voting & meetings
One vote per Membership; can be suspended for violations or delinquent assessments (Article VIII, Section 2; Article III, Se)
Amendments
Original Declaration provided for amendment by majority vote of owners; this Declaration is an amendment approved by majority vote or more (Recitals C and D)
